Kristian 2014-12-23 11:46 GMT+01:00 sebb <seb...@gmail.com>: > On 22 December 2014 at 15:24, <krosenv...@apache.org> wrote: >> Author: krosenvold >> Date: Mon Dec 22 15:24:02 2014 >> New Revision: 1647329 >> >> URL: http://svn.apache.org/r1647329 >> Log: >> COMPRESS-296 Parallel compression. Added StreamCompressor and >> ScatterZipOutputStream. >> >> StreamCompressor is an extract of the deflation algorithm from >> ZipArchiveOutputStream, which unfortunately >> was too conflated with writing a file in a particular structure. Using the >> actual zip file format as an >> intermediate format for scatter-streams turned out to be fairly inefficient. >> ScatterZipOuputStream >> is 2-3x faster than using a zip file as intermediate format. >> >> It would be possibly to refactor ZipArchiveOutputStream to use >> StreamCompressor, but there would >> be a slight break in backward compatibility regarding the protected writeOut >> method, which >> is moved to the streamCompressor class. >> >> Added: >> >> commons/proper/compress/trunk/src/main/java/org/apache/commons/compress/archivers/zip/ScatterZipOutputStream.java >> >> commons/proper/compress/trunk/src/main/java/org/apache/commons/compress/archivers/zip/StreamCompressor.java >> >> commons/proper/compress/trunk/src/test/java/org/apache/commons/compress/archivers/zip/ScatterZipOutputStreamTest.java >> >> commons/proper/compress/trunk/src/test/java/org/apache/commons/compress/archivers/zip/StreamCompressorTest.java >> Modified: >> >> commons/proper/compress/trunk/src/main/java/org/apache/commons/compress/archivers/zip/ZipArchiveOutputStream.java >> >> commons/proper/compress/trunk/src/test/java/org/apache/commons/compress/archivers/ZipTestCase.java >> >> Added: >> commons/proper/compress/trunk/src/main/java/org/apache/commons/compress/archivers/zip/ScatterZipOutputStream.java >> URL: >> http://svn.apache.org/viewvc/commons/proper/compress/trunk/src/main/java/org/apache/commons/compress/archivers/zip/ScatterZipOutputStream.java?rev=1647329&view=auto >> ============================================================================== >> --- >> commons/proper/compress/trunk/src/main/java/org/apache/commons/compress/archivers/zip/ScatterZipOutputStream.java >> (added) >> +++ >> commons/proper/compress/trunk/src/main/java/org/apache/commons/compress/archivers/zip/ScatterZipOutputStream.java >> Mon Dec 22 15:24:02 2014 >> @@ -0,0 +1,174 @@ >> +/* >> + * Licensed to the Apache Software Foundation (ASF) under one or more >> + * contributor license agreements.
